Original description:
When I press the Publish button, Shotwell performs some network activity before displaying the Publish Photos dialog. During this time Shotwell is hung (menus are unresponsive) and there's no indication that a network operation is in progress.
Instead, during this time (as always when we communicate over the network) we should indicate that an operation is in progress and we should give the user some way to cancel the operation. One way to do this would be to display the Publish Photos dialog immediately and to display the text “Connecting…†inside it.
